Folex has launched a roll-up material with a textured anti-reflective look to the surface that also provides scratch resistance and gives the impression of a laminated print. The ink receptive coating - suitable for eco-solvent and solvent inks – is said to have an absorbent coating structure for faster ink penetration. The film is also perfectly suited to latex and UV ink printing.

Signs Express is increasing the start-up package contributions for new franchisees. The announcement was made at the network’s annual convention at the Hilton Deansgate Hotel in Manchester, where it was celebrating its 25th anniversary of franchising. Managing director Craig Brown also used the opportunity to set out plans for the coming years, including investment in staff and infrastructure to grow the support available to franchisees.

AXYZ International will hold an open day in north London on 24 January. It will be held at the Royal Air Force Museum in Edgware. The main focus of the event will be on the upgraded AXYZ Trident hybrid CNC machine. Also on show will be an AXYZ series router with new options, including a new kiss-cut knife unit, a new high-speed router spindle and an expanded ATC (Automatic Tool Change) facility.

Specialty paper manufacturer Felix Schoeller group will be increasing the prices of all its paper products from 1 January 2018. It cites escalating prices for raw materials, especially the two most important ones - pulp and titanium dioxide - as the reason for this move.

Sophie Matthews-Paul, the veteran print technology and communications consultant, has died at her home in Herefordshire, UK. Diagnosed with an aggressive cancer in January of this year and given a six-month prognosis, Sophie had a peaceful departure, in the presence of her son, James. She was 68 years old.
